Masrour Barzani discusses joint cooperation with the Governor of the Central Bank of Iraq

General

The Prime Minister of the Kurdistan Regional Government, Masrour Barzani, received today, Monday, the Governor of the Central Bank of Iraq, Ali Mohsen Al-Alaq. A statement by the regional government stated: "Barzani highlighted the reforms achieved in the banking sector in the Kurdistan Region, and touched on the (My Account) banking project, in which the number of registered public sector salary recipients has exceeded half a million individuals so far, as it is expected that the salaries of two hundred thousand new registrants will be disbursed through (My Account) next month." The two sides agreed on the importance of continuing the project, and supporting and following up on the Central Bank. Masrour Barzani expressed his thanks to the Governor of the Central Bank for his distinguished support for the (My Account) project, and for the banking reforms in the regional government, pointing to the growing interest of local and international financial institutions in coordination, cooperation and support f or the financial strategy of the regional government. The meeting also discussed accelerating the achievement of financial inclusion in the Kurdistan Region, as part of the strategic goals of the Central Bank of Iraq and its steps towards digitizing the banking sector.
